What is libkseexpr4
libkseexpr4 is:
SeExpr is an embeddable, arithmetic expression language that enables flexible artistic control and customization in creating computer graphics images. Example uses include procedural geometry synthesis, image synthesis, simulation control, crowd animation, and geometry deformation.
KSeExpr is a fork of SeExpr mainly used for Krita.
This package contains the core shared library.

Install libkseexpr4 Using apt-get
Update apt database with apt-get
using the following command.
sudo apt-get update
After updating apt database, We can install libkseexpr4
using apt-get
by running the following command:
sudo apt-get -y install libkseexpr4

How To Uninstall libkseexpr4 on Debian 12
To uninstall only the libkseexpr4
package we can use the following command:
sudo apt-get remove libkseexpr4
Uninstall libkseexpr4 And Its Dependencies
To uninstall libkseexpr4
and its dependencies that are no longer needed by Debian 12, we can use the command below:
sudo apt-get -y autoremove libkseexpr4
Remove libkseexpr4 Configurations and Data
To remove libkseexpr4
configuration and data from Debian 12 we can use the following command:
sudo apt-get -y purge libkseexpr4
Remove libkseexpr4 configuration, data, and all of its dependencies
We can use the following command to remove libkseexpr4
configurations, data and all of its dependencies, we can use the following command:
sudo apt-get -y autoremove --purge libkseexpr4
